Psychiatrists
A psychiatrist is the best option to seek help for an illness of the mind. A psychiatrist is a medical professional who is trained in the field of mental health. They can diagnose conditions and prescribe medicine. They may also provide talk therapy, also known as psychotherapy. Psychiatrists are employed in private practice or hospitals. Some specialize in specific areas, like child and adolescent or geriatric mental health.
A Psychiatrist in my region is a mental health professional who can assist with depression, alcohol or drug abuse eating disorders, depression, and other issues. They can treat adults and children alike. They may also refer you to other professionals for additional assistance.
Psychiatrists also provide a wide variety of mental health services. These include family counseling, which can help improve your relationship with your family members. They also provide groups of people who have similar issues. They can also perform psychological assessments that will help you determine the reason behind your behavior.

Psychologists are trained experts in psychology who diagnose and treat mental health issues such as depression, anxiety and bipolar disorder. They work with individuals, couples, and families in order to assist them in resolving difficult issues. They may employ a variety of treatment methods that include individual and group therapy, family therapy and cognitive behavioral therapy. Psychologists use a variety tests to determine the state of their mental wellbeing and determine the cause for symptoms.

You should also consider which type of therapy matches your personality. If you are suffering with anxiety, it could be beneficial to find an therapist who utilizes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, which is focused on changing negative thinking patterns and behaviors. Another type of therapy is Dialectical Behavioral Therapy (DBT) which assists patients in learning strategies to manage their distress, tolerate conflict, and connect with others.

Psychoanalysts
Psychoanalytic therapy is insight-driven and aims to foster change by helping you to understand what events in your past might have contributed to mental stress. Your psychotherapist will talk with you in a safe environment that is non-judgmental and listens to your concerns. They will also seek out unconscious patterns and feelings and see how they relate to your current situation. Psychoanalytic therapists are trained to identify these hidden patterns and assist you in understanding the underlying causes.
This type of treatment may require a long time. The average analysis can last from between three and seven years. This is because the techniques employed by psychoanalysts are complicated and require a lot of training to master. Some therapists choose to focus on this type of therapy, while others are generalists and deal with clients of different backgrounds.
For a long time psychoanalytic training has focused on certain criteria like verbal communication and the ability to manage one's impulses. These criteria have resulted in the exclusion of ethnic minorities and people of different genders, and low-income people from psychoanalytic treatment. This has led to negative stereotypes of White middle-upper-class therapists to minority and working-class clients.
This issue has been addressed by several therapists who use psychoanalytical techniques. Arthur Ramos, a Brazilian psychiatrist, utilized his experiences to challenge the notions of eugenics in the time and White supremacy in mainstream psychotherapy. He also wrote extensively about the importance of introspection, accepting one's heritage, and identifying social justice as the root cause of neurosis.
Another important aspect of psychoanalytic treatment is the focus on collaboration and partnerships between the therapist and their patients. This is in contrast to the traditional physician-patient model, where the therapist acts as the "expert" and is seen as the sole source of knowledge. This type of collaboration and partnership is especially essential for psychoanalytic therapists working with patients of diverse backgrounds.
